Description
We are seeking a dynamic and results-driven Account / Sales Manager to join a growing Sales team within the Water Treatment sector. This is an excellent opportunity for a commercially driven individual to manage key client relationships, drive business growth, and deliver high levels of customer satisfaction across an established portfolio. Key Responsibilities • Develop and maintain strong relationships with existing Water Treatment clients, understanding their needs and delivering tailored solutions • Identify, develop, and convert new business opportunities within Water Treatment and Water Hygiene markets • Build and manage a strong sales pipeline, consistently achieving and exceeding revenue targets • Negotiate contracts, pricing, and terms to secure mutually beneficial agreements • Prepare and deliver proposals, tenders, and client presentations • Conduct site visits and technical consultations to understand client requirements • Collaborate with internal technical and operational teams to ensure successful service delivery • Lead client meetings and maintain clear communication on projects, updates, and performance • Produce reports and analyse sales data using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) • Develop long-term relationships with key stakeholders including Facilities Managers, Engineers, and Procurement teams • Represent the business at industry events and networking opportunities Key Requirements • Proven experience within the Water Treatment industry (essential) • Strong background in account management and business development • Demonstrable track record of achieving sales targets • Solid understanding of Legionella control and compliance frameworks such as ACoP L8 and HSG 274 • Excellent communication, negotiation, and presentation skills • Ability to translate technical information into clear, client-focused solutions • Highly self-motivated, organised, and target-driven • Industry certifications in water treatment or Legionella control (desirable) • Full UK driving licence and willingness to travel across the UK • Proficient in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) Package • Basic salary from £40K • Commission structure • Company car • Pension • Laptop & mobile phone • Company events • Career development opportunities
